St. Theresa Catholic School

St. Theresa Catholic School serves 223 students in grades Prekindergarten-8, is a member of the National Catholic Educational Association (NCEA).
The student:teacher of St. Theresa Catholic School is 19: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Catholic.

Frequently Asked Questions

What sports does St. Theresa Catholic School offer?
St. Theresa Catholic School offers 5 interscholastic sports: Basketball, Cheering, Football, Golf and Volleyball.
When is the application deadline for St. Theresa Catholic School?
The application deadline for St. Theresa Catholic School is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
In what neighborhood is St. Theresa Catholic School located?
St. Theresa Catholic School is located in the Coverdale And Watson neighborhood of Little Rock, AR.
